The Bosch Rexroth LINEAR-SET LSAC-50-DD-NR-G (R102725034) is a high-quality linear motion system designed to provide precise and smooth linear movement in various applications. This linear set is constructed from lightweight precision aluminum housing, making it a durable yet light solution for motion requirements. It features a compact LB, closed format of linear bushings that are corrosion-resistant and come with integrated wiper seals on both sides, ensuring clean operation even in challenging environments. The LSAC-50-DD-NR-G is equipped with a shaft diameter of 50 mm and has been greased with Dynalub for optimal performance right from the start. The initial lubrication helps to reduce maintenance needs and prolongs the service life of the unit. Effect of load direction on load rating
The listed load ratings should be chosen depending on installation in minimum or maximum position and should be based on the calculations. If the load direction is clearly defined and the Linear Bushings can be installed in maximum position, the load ratings Cmax. (dynamic load rating) and C0 max (static load rating) can be used. If aligned installation is not possible or the load direction is not defined, the minimum load ratings must be used.
Reduced load capacity with short stroke
In case of short stroke, the service life of the shafts is less than that of Linear Bushings. The load ratings C specified in the tables must therefore be multiplied by the factor f.s .

Initial lubrication
Linear bushings come with initial lubrication. Grease the Linear Bushings before use. Service life data is based on initial lubrication and relubricated Linear Bushings.
